Newbury Guest House
4.5/5100 Reviews
Downtown Boston
This hotel was lovely! We have stayed at many hotels in Boston and it is always overpriced. This hotel was reasonably priced (for Boston) and was in a beautiful location right on Newbury St among all the shops and a block away from Copley square. It was also very close to the T allowing for quick travel to various locations. The king room with bay window was spacious and clean. The view onto Newbury made you feel like you lived in Boston. Also, there were some tasty cookies in the lobby. We would definitely stay here again.

Oasis Guest House
4.5/5105 Reviews
Fenway Kenmore
I stayed at the Oasis Guest House for a couple of nights in early July. I had booked a 1 person shared bathroom room but was upgraded to an ensuite room. I loved staying at the Oasis Guest House. There's something very comforting about seeing the same faces at the front desk every day. Being able to have a friendly chat with them about the neighborhood as you come home or head out. Staying in a place that blends into the neighborhood rather than seeking to dominate it. Boston is a very walkable city with great public transportation options and the Oasis Guest House is well situated to let you head out and explore the city. The property is centrally air conditioned and kept at a comfortable temperature. There was also a small fan in the room which I didn't need but was nice to have on hand. There was also a spare blanket in the dresser which I didn't need but was nice to have on hand. The room was not large but was perfectly comfortable and a very relaxing place to return to after a day of walking around the city. The bathroom was very clean. The shower space was a bit tight but worked well. I will definitely be returning to the Oasis Guest House on my next trip to Boston.
